THE COURTS
Court News
LISBON — A Wellsville man accused of trying to harm a woman and damaging her car window last year pleaded guilty to fourth-degree felony aggravated assault, and misdemeanors of assault and criminal damaging, with sentencing set for April 24.
James B. Oiler, 42, First Street, Wellsville, recently appeared in Columbiana County Common Pleas Court to enter the plea. The aggravated assault charge was a lesser offense of felonious assault, a second-degree felony.
He was accused of purposefully driving his vehicle left of center to strike a vehicle driven by a woman on Birch Road in St. Clair Township in an attempt to cause harm on Feb. 14, 2025. He also punched the driver side window of the car, causing the woman to flee out of the passenger door.
